Saudi Arabia - Import of Oysters

Since 2014, Saudi Arabia Import of Oysters increased 34.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 34 comparing other countries in Import of Oysters at $487,148.38. Saudi Arabia is overtaken by Brunei, which was number 33 with $492,400.97 and is followed by South Africa with $420,070.2. France topped the ranking with $40,317,510.47 in 2019, that is +3.1% versus 2018. China, United States and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Uganda witnessed the best average annual growth at +138.5% per year, while South Korea recorded the worst performance at -67% per year.
